Default Finally had some real fun

Well after countless attemps to fix the binding, I found that atleast with mine, if I took the small bearing out in ran smooth, super smooth so I packed some thick grease in the hole. I just got 11 minutes runtime off the stock battery with super slow crawl control, never binded up once. What worse could happen? Stripped gears well they are crap anyways. It is worth a try if yours in not drivable. WIll update if something bad happens.

Update, This thing runs Killer without the small bearing. The shaft has a little wobble to it. But it runs smooth as silk. NO BINDING AT ALL. Runtime with Micro High Roller Pack is over 15 minutes. I have ran it hard to, works great I can crawl really slow with great control. Has anyone else tried it yet????????????

I would like to try it...where is the bearing? I havent took the tranny apart yet so im not familar with the insides. What kind of grease did you use?

thanx

When you take the cover off there will be 2 bearings. The smaller one is at the top right. You will see it as soon as you take the cover off. I just used regular Red High Temp Grease from Wal-Mart mixed with some Diff lube.
